The Owl in Folklore

Owls have long been creatures of myth and legend. In ancient Greece, the owl was sacred to Athena, the goddess of wisdom and war strategy. To wear an owl charm was to invite clarity of thought and insight. Greek coins from as early as the 5th century BCE even feature the owl as a symbol of knowledge and protection.

In Celtic folklore, owls were regarded as guardians of the underworld and keepers of hidden truths. They were thought to guide souls through the darkness, which is why they are often linked to transition and mystery.

For many Native American tribes, the owl is a messenger of secrets and intuition, believed to reveal unseen truths or foretell events. While some traditions associated the owl with warnings, others celebrated it as a spirit guide leading people to wisdom and self-discovery.

Across the world, owls are consistently tied to the mystical, the protective, and the wise—all qualities that translate beautifully when represented in jewellery.

 

Personality Traits and Symbolism

 

When worn as jewellery, owls carry symbolic meanings that can resonate with the wearer’s personality:

  • Wisdom & Knowledge – A reminder of intelligence, experience, and thoughtful decision-making.
  • Intuition & Perception – The owl sees in the dark, symbolising clarity when others are clouded by confusion.
  • Independence – Owls are solitary hunters, making them a symbol of self-reliance.
  • Mystery & Magic – Often linked to the unseen, owls represent curiosity about the unknown.

People who feel drawn to owls often share traits such as being observant, reflective, and independent.

The Owl in Jewellery Design

Owl motifs in jewellery range from delicate and stylised pendants to ornate brooches with gemstone eyes that shimmer like the creature’s night vision. Sterling silver, with its reflective, moon-like quality, often enhances the mystical feel of owl-inspired designs. Gold can symbolise the owl’s association with wisdom and divinity, while gemstones such as onyx, moonstone, or sapphire enhance its mysterious qualities.
